三種連接的語法

為便於更多的技友快速讀懂、理解,我們只討論2張表對象進行連接操作的情況,大於2張表對象進行的連接操作原理也是一樣的。

1.左連接(LEFT JOIN )

SELECT M.columnname……,N.* columnname…..

FROM left_table M LEFT JOIN right_table N ON M.columnname_join=N.columnname_join AND N.columnname=XXX

WHERE M.columnname=XXX…..

2.右連接(RIGHT JOIN)
SELECT M.columnname……,N.* columnname…..

FROM left_table M RIGHT JOIN right_table N ON M. columnname_join=N. columnname_join AND M. columnname=XXX

WHERE N.columnname=XXX…..

3.等值連接

SELECT M.columnname……,N.* columnname…..

FROM left_table M [INNER] JOIN right_table N ON M. columnname_join=N. columnname_join

WHERE M.columnname=XXX….. AND N.columnname=XXX….

或者

SELECT M.columnname……,N.* columnname…..

FROM left_table M , right_table N

WHERE M. columnname_join=N. columnname_join AND
M.columnname=XXX….. AND N.columnname=XXX….

說明:

A.左連接(LEFT JOIN )

ON字句連接條件,用於把2表中等值的記錄連接在一起,但是不影響記錄集的數量。若是表left_table中的某記錄,無法在表right_table找到對應的記錄,則此記錄依然顯示在記錄集鐘,只是表 right_table需要在查詢顯示的列的值用NULL替代;

ON字句連接條件中表right_table.columnname=XXX用於控制right_table表是否有符合要求的列值還是用NULL替換的方式顯示在查詢列中,不影響記錄集的數量;

WHERE字句控制記錄是否符合查詢要求,不符合則過濾掉;

簡單點說,就是 “left_table.columnname_join=right_table.columnname_join”用於統計兩個表的等值連接的記錄集,on子句
連接條件就是限制right_table的記錄集大小,where子句的條件是限制最終結果集的大小。最終結果集的大小是顯示“left_table“表的所有記錄,和“left_table“匹配的”right_table“的記錄顯示”right_table“列值,不匹配的話,顯示對應的”right_table“顯示為null(最終結果集的大小是left_table刨除where條件的記錄數)


B.右連接(RIGHT JOIN)

ON子句連接條件,用於把2表中等值的記錄連接在一起,若是表right_table中的某記錄,無法在表left_table找到對應的記錄,則表 left_table需要在查詢顯示的列的值用NULL替代;

ON子句連接條件中表left_table.columnname=XXX用於控制left_table表是否有符合要求的列值,還是用NULL替換的方式顯示在查詢列表中;

WHERE字句控制記錄是否符合查詢要求,不符合則過濾掉;

簡單點說,就是 “left_table.columnname_join=right_table.columnname_join”用於統計兩個表的等值連接的記錄集,on子句
連接條件就是限制left_table的記錄集大小,where子句的條件是限制最終結果集的大小。最終結果集的大小是顯示“right_table”表的所有記錄,和“right_table“匹配的”left_table“的記錄顯示”left_table“列值,不匹配的話,顯示對應的”left_table“顯示為null(最終結果集的大小是left_table刨除where條件的記錄數)


C. 等值連接

ON子句連接條件,不再與左連接或右連接的功效一樣,除了作為2表記錄匹配的條件外,還會起到過濾記錄的作用,若left_table中記錄無法在right_table中找到對應的記錄,則會被過濾掉;

WHERE字句,不管是涉及表left_table、表right_table上的限制條件,還是涉及2表連接的條件,都會對記錄集起到過濾作用,把不符合要求的記錄刷選掉;



測試數據:

創建表
mysql> CREATE TABLE left_table(ID INT UNSIGNED NOT NULL AUTO_INCREMENT,
-> Username VARCHAR(40) NOT NULL,
-> Birthday DATETIME NOT NULL DEFAULT ‘0000-00-00 00:00:00‘,
-> CityID SMALLINT NOT NULL DEFAULT 0,
-> CreatDate TIMESTAMP NOT NULL DEFAULT ‘0000-00-00 00:00:00‘,
-> AlterDate TIMESTAMP NOT NULL DEFAULT CURRENT_TIMESTAMP ON UPDATE CURRENT_TIMESTAMP,
-> PRIMARY KEY(ID),
-> KEY idx_username(Username)
-> )ENGINE=InnoDB CHARACTER SET ‘utf8‘ COLLATE ‘utf8_general_ci‘;
Query OK, 0 rows affected (0.11 sec)

mysql>
mysql> CREATE TABLE right_table(UID INT UNSIGNED NOT NULL ,
-> CollectNum MEDIUMINT NOT NULL DEFAULT 0,
-> BuyNum MEDIUMINT NOT NULL DEFAULT 0,
-> SearchNum MEDIUMINT NOT NULL DEFAULT 0,
-> CreatDate TIMESTAMP NOT NULL DEFAULT ‘0000-00-00 00:00:00‘,
-> AlterDate TIMESTAMP NOT NULL DEFAULT CURRENT_TIMESTAMP ON UPDATE CURRENT_TIMESTAMP,
-> PRIMARY KEY(UID)
-> )ENGINE=InnoDB CHARACTER SET ‘utf8‘ COLLATE ‘utf8_general_ci‘;
Query OK, 0 rows affected (0.00 sec)

插入測試數據

執行如下sql十次
INSERT INTO left_table(Username,Birthday,CityID,CreatDate,AlterDate)
VALUES(CONCAT(SUBSTRING(RAND(),3,8),‘@qq.com‘),DATE_ADD(NOW(),INTERVAL -SUBSTRING(RAND(),3,2) YEAR),SUBSTRING(RAND(),3,2),DATE_ADD(NOW(),INTERVAL -SUBSTRING(RAND(),3,3) DAY),DATE_ADD(NOW(),INTERVAL -SUBSTRING(RAND(),3,2) DAY));


執行一次如下sql
INSERT INTO right_table
SELECT ID,SUBSTRING(RAND(),3,4) AS CollectNum,SUBSTRING(RAND(),3,2) AS BuyNum,SUBSTRING(RAND(),3,3) AS SearchNum,CreatDate,AlterDate FROM left_table WHERE ID%5=1;

查看基礎數據:

左連接(left join)

編號:sql_1
mysql> select m.id,m.username,n.CollectNum,n.BuyNum from left_table m left join right_table n on m.id=n.uid where m.id <=6;
+----+-----------------+------------+--------+
| id | username | CollectNum | BuyNum |
+----+-----------------+------------+--------+
| 1 | [email protected] | 2545 | 78 |
| 2 | [email protected] | NULL | NULL |
| 3 | [email protected] | NULL | NULL |
| 4 | [email protected] | NULL | NULL |
| 5 | [email protected] | NULL | NULL |
| 6 | [email protected] | 4951 | 96 |
+----+-----------------+------------+--------+
6 rows in set (0.02 sec)

編號:sql_2
mysql> select m.id,m.username,n.CollectNum,n.BuyNum from left_table m left join right_table n on m.id=n.uid and n.SearchNum>300 where m.id <=6;
+----+-----------------+------------+--------+
| id | username | CollectNum | BuyNum |
+----+-----------------+------------+--------+
| 1 | [email protected] | NULL | NULL |
| 2 | [email protected] | NULL | NULL |
| 3 | [email protected] | NULL | NULL |
| 4 | [email protected] | NULL | NULL |
| 5 | [email protected] | NULL | NULL |
| 6 | [email protected] | 4951 | 96 |
+----+-----------------+------------+--------+
6 rows in set (0.00 sec)

sql_1和sql_2對比
1.兩個結果集的記錄數是一樣的,left_table顯示的列值是一樣的
2.兩個結果集中right_table相應列值是不一樣的

為什麽會不一樣呢?
兩個記錄集的記錄數是一樣的,那是因為兩個sql的where條件是一樣,即最終的結果集的數量就會一樣,right_table相應的列值不一樣那是因為在on的條件中sql_2過濾掉了right_table的符合條件的記錄。


右連接也就類似了,下面說下等值連接。

帶join的等值連接
mysql> select m.id,m.username,n.CollectNum,n.BuyNum
-> from left_table m inner join right_table n on m.id=n.uid
-> where m.id<=6;
+----+-----------------+------------+--------+
| id | username | CollectNum | BuyNum |
+----+-----------------+------------+--------+
| 1 | [email protected] | 2545 | 78 |
| 6 | [email protected] | 4951 | 96 |
+----+-----------------+------------+--------+
2 rows in set (0.00 sec)


mysql> select m.id,m.username,n.CollectNum,n.BuyNum from left_table m inner join right_table n on m.id=n.uid and n.SearchNum >300 where m.id<=6;
+----+-----------------+------------+--------+
| id | username | CollectNum | BuyNum |
+----+-----------------+------------+--------+
| 6 | [email protected] | 4951 | 96 |
+----+-----------------+------------+--------+
1 row in set (0.01 sec)

從上面的可以看到,這裏的on有了過濾最終結果集的大小的作用了

不帶join的等值連接(這種方式我用著比較舒服,因為一直用oracle的)
mysql> select m.id,m.username,n.CollectNum,n.BuyNum
-> from left_table m,right_table n
-> where m.id=n.uid and m.id<=6;
+----+-----------------+------------+--------+
| id | username | CollectNum | BuyNum |
+----+-----------------+------------+--------+
| 1 | [email protected] | 2545 | 78 |
| 6 | [email protected] | 4951 | 96 |
+----+-----------------+------------+--------+
2 rows in set (0.00 sec)

mysql>
